Cream cheese pound cake recipe ✨✨

Wait cause this cake was soo good. I received nothing but compliments using this recipe for Thanksgiving. I’m no gate keeper soooooo here’s the recipe. Try it out and let me know how it comes out for you ❤️

- 4 sticks butter

- 4 cups sugar

- 4 cups flour (all purpose/cake flour)

- 8oz cream cheese

- 8 large eggs

- 4tsp flavor of your choice

Baked in a cooled oven at 300 for an hour then 325 for about 30mins. I used Pam baking spray to coat my Bundt pan. #bakingsweetness #bundtcakeperfection #poundcakerecipe #bakewithme

... Read moreOne tip I've found helpful when making cream cheese pound cake is to ensure the cream cheese and butter are softened to room temperature before mixing. This helps create a smooth batter and prevents lumps. Also, I recommend using cake flour if possible to achieve a lighter texture. If you only have all-purpose flour, it's still great—just be sure to measure carefully. For baking, preheating the oven to a lower temperature initially and then increasing it halfway through, as described, results in a tender crumb and a lightly crusty exterior. Using a non-stick baking spray like Pam on a Bundt pan really helps with an easy release. You can personalize the flavor by adding vanilla extract, almond extract, or even lemon zest for a fresh twist. Additionally, some of my favorite variations include topping the cake with a cream cheese icing or dusting with powdered sugar for extra sweetness.
